Teaching reading with music doesn’t mean you have to sing! Our special guest, Jocelyn Manzanerez, explains how rhythm, beats, and chants can enhance literacy skills—no microphone required.
In this episode, we'll talk about:
Join us as we uncover practical ways to make reading instruction more engaging and effective with music, even if you’re not a singer! Jocelyn shares her expertise on making literacy instruction fun and accessible for all educators.
